Freaking out about threadworms

I recently discovered that my 9 month old baby has threadworms. I have no idea how long he's had them but he's always been unsettled during late evening so he could have had them for ages Sad. I always checked his nappies and never saw anything but decided to check his bum after he'd gone to sleep one evening because my older dd was complaining of an itchy bum. What a shock i got! So the past few nights I've been removing any that i see and washing his bum thoroughly first thing in the morning. I'm constantly washing bedding (he sleeps with me), damp dusting, hovering. I'm paranoid that the eggs are everywhere around me. How will i ever get rid of these blighters when neither he nor i can take medication to kill them (i'm bf).

It's horrible to think of all those bastard worms crawling around inside him and i hate seeing them on him. I feel like I'm going crazy about it though. My two other kids have been treated but are under strict instructions to shower and wash bums before anything in the morning.

Is there anything else i can do?

Take baby to GP I'm sure the GP can prescribe something for children under 2. Make sure you treat everyone else and then again in two weeks. Keep finger nails short. Wash(scrub) everyone's hands in am. Ensure underwear and PJs worn for bed. Horrible things.
